    Feasibility the Using of Coffee Waste for Bali Cattle Fattening in Bangli

    Get PDF
    In Bali, one of the important issues related to livestock development is the issue of feed. The farmers often complain because of high prices of feed that often do not correspond to price of product increase. One of the alternatives for the provision of feed that are cheap and competitive is through the utilization of plantation waste. To view the financial feasibility of livestock farmers is introducting of coffee waste research in the Belantih Village, District of Kintamani, Bangli Regency. The eligible criteria used is Net Present Value (NPV), B/C ratio and the Internal Rate of Return (IRR), followed by the sensitivity test. From the analysis it was founded that the addition of coffee bran into the feed (forage + biocas) of fattening cattle to include net income (year 0 up to 10th) against level discount factor (df) 12% obtained NPV of Rp. 15,079,587.91; IRR of 21% and B/C ratio of 2.62. In farm of fattening who were given forage just acquired a negative NPV of Rp. 14,547,191.50; 1% IRR and B/C ratio of 1.04. From the economic analysis, it was concluded that the using coffee bran is feasible to be introduced due to B/C1 compared to the usual management by the farmers.     Clinical and Cerebrospinal Fluid Abnormalities as Diagnostic Tools of Tuberculous Meningitis

    Get PDF
    Background: Tuberculous meningitis (TBM) is the most severe form of extrapulmonary tuberculous (TB) disease and remains difficult to diagnose. The aim of the study was to determine the diagnostic value of clinical and laboratory findings of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) examinations for diagnosing TBM using bacterial culture result as the gold standard.Methods: A prospective cross sectional study was carried out to 121 medical records of hospitalized TBM patients in neurological ward at Dr. Hasan Sadikin General Hospital Bandung, from 1 January 2009–31 May 2013. The inclusion criteria were medical records consisted of clinical manisfestations and laboratory findings. The clinical manisfestations were headache and nuchal rigidity, whereas the laboratory findings were CSF chemical analysis (protein, glucose, and cells) and CSF microbiological culture. Validity such as s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value (PPV), negative predictive value (NPV) for clinical and laboratory findings were calculated, using bacterial culture result as the gold standard.Results: The most clinical findings of TBM was nuchal rigidity and it had the highest sensitivity value, but the lowest spesificity value. Decreased of CSF glucose had the highest sensitivity value compared to other laboratory findings, but the value was low.Conclusions: The clinical manisfestations and the laboratory findings are not sensitive and specific enough for diagnosing TBM.     Difference in Immature Reticulocyte Fraction Percentage between Moderate and Severe Anemia in Transfusion-Dependent Thalassemia

    Get PDF
    Thalassemia is an inherited genetic disease caused by the disruption in globin chain synthesis. Inefective erythropoiesis in thalassemia leads to moderate to severe anemia, requiring routine blood transfusions. To evaluate erythropoiesis, immature reticulocyte fractions (IRF) can be measured using the hematology analyzer, avoiding the need of invasive bone marrow examination. The purpose of this study was to analyze the differences in the IRF percentage between moderate and severe anemia in transfusion-dependent thalassemia (TDT) patients. This was a cross-sectional comparative observational analytic study conducted at the Pediatric Thalassemia Clinic of Dr. Hasan Sadikin General Hospital Bandung in August–September 2020. The IRF was examined using the fluorescence flowcytometry method with whole blood sample added by EDTA anticoagulant. The statistical analysis used in this study was unpaired t-test and Mann Whitney’s test. Subjects were 93 TDT pediatric patients, consisting of 48 boys (52%) and 45 girls (48%). The majority (72%) of the patients had been diagnosed with thalassemia for more than 5 years with moderate anemia (40%) and severe anemia (60%). The median IRF percentage in moderate anemia was 6.4% (range 0-22.7) while the range in severe anemia was 11.7% (range 4.1–35.8), suggesting a statistically significant difference (p<0.001) in the IRF percentage between moderate and severe anemia in transfusion-dependent thalassemia patients. To conclude, the more severe the anemia experienced by a thalassemia patient is, the higher the percentage of IRF
